Hanfu horse-face skirts highlight the charm of traditional culture
According to The Paper, during the Spring Festival this year, Hanfu not only appeared on the CCTV Spring Festival Gala, but also entered ordinary streets. Some places even launched a "free subway ride with Hanfu" campaign. Big data from multiple e-commerce platforms shows that since the beginning of this year, searches for Hanfu have skyrocketed, and horse-faced skirts have become the most popular item in the Hanfu category. The horse-faced skirt once became the "New Year's jersey", triggering a wave of traditional cultural consumption. How popular is the horse-faced skirt? In Caoxian County, Shandong, a Hanfu distribution center, sales of Dragon Year clothing, mainly horse-faced skirts, have exceeded 300 million yuan. People can be seen wearing horse-faced skirts in cultural evening parties and temple fair performances at tourist attractions in Luoyang, Henan, and Quanzhou, Fujian. As one of the representatives of traditional Chinese clothing, the horse-faced skirt has taken on new vitality in modern society and has become a commercial phenomenon. This not only shows the charm of traditional culture, but also highlights its infinite possibilities in modern society. The Hanfu horse-face skirt transitions from traditional to top-tier fashion
During this year’s Spring Festival, social media platforms were dominated by photos of tourists wearing horse-faced skirts. The Forbidden City and Temple of Heaven in Beijing, Yingtianmen in Luoyang and Riverside Garden during the Qingming Festival in Kaifeng, the compatibility between the horse-faced skirt and the red-walled antique style is exciting, and makes people marvel at the beauty of Chinese clothing. During the Spring Festival of the Year of the Dragon, horse-faced skirts have unexpectedly but unexpectedly become a hit item. Many consumers have purchased horse-faced skirts as their New Year’s “shirts,” and even more people have chosen horse-faced skirts as their first Hanfu item. Face skirt. Big data shows that during the "Double Eleven" period in 2023, Taobao sold more than 730,000 horse-faced skirts. Horse-faced skirts have become the most popular item in the Hanfu category. The reporter searched on various e-commerce platforms and found that the sales of some hot-selling styles of horse-faced skirts exceeded one million yuan. According to reports, in Cao County alone, the sales of Year of the Dragon New Year greeting clothes, mainly horse-face skirts, in 2023 have exceeded 300 million yuan. Traditional Chinese Costume: The Hanfu Horse-Face Skirt
Horse-faced skirt, also known as "horse-faced pleated skirt", is one of the main skirt styles for women in ancient China. There are four skirt doors at the front, back and outside, two of which overlap. The outer skirt door is decorated, and the inner skirt door has less or no decoration. , the horse-faced skirt is pleated on the sides, and the waist of the skirt is mostly made of white cloth, which means growing old together, and is tied with ropes or buttons. The word "horse face" first appeared in "History of the Ming Palace": "The drag strip has a continuous back collar, and there are swings on the sides, the front collar has two sections, and there are horse face pleats underneath, rising to both sides." But. The history of horse-faced skirts can be traced back to the Song Dynasty, because skirts in the Song Dynasty already had the shape of horse-faced skirts. The spiral skirt is a functional "crotch-opening skirt" designed for women in the Song Dynasty to facilitate riding donkeys. Hanfu, a traditional Chinese cultural attire
Hanfu, the full name of "Han nationality traditional clothing", was created during the more than 4,000 years from the accession of the Yellow Emperor to the late Ming Dynasty (the middle of the 17th century AD), centered on Chinese etiquette culture, through the admiration of Zhou rites and the laws of heaven and earth through successive Han dynasties. The ceremonial dress system formed. Hanfu carries China’s outstanding craftsmanship and aesthetics such as dyeing, weaving and embroidery. The history of Hanfu is the history of the development of Han nationality clothing, and its history has a long history. The history of Hanfu can be traced back to ancient times, around 3000 BC. At first, people used woven linen to make clothes. Later, silkworm breeding and silk spinning were invented, and clothes and clothing gradually became complete. In the Huangdi era, crowns appeared and the clothing system gradually took shape. After the Xia and Shang Dynasties, the crown service system was initially established, and gradually became complete during the Western Zhou Dynasty. Qixiong Ruqun - Understanding Traditional Hanfu
[Tips on Hanfu] Chest-length underskirt Chest-length skirt is a name for a unique women's skirt during the Sui, Tang and Five Dynasties. It is a type of traditional clothing of the Han nationality. Since the Han and Jin Dynasties, the skirt of the skirt has been tied around the waist. In ancient times, most women's skirts were not tied very high. However, from the Northern and Southern Dynasties to the Sui, Tang and Five Dynasties, a kind of skirt with a very high waist appeared. In some clothing history, it is often called a high-waisted skirt. High-waisted skirt is just a common name. According to people's current research on it, it is generally called chest-length skirt. We often say that we prostrate ourselves under the pomegranate skirt, which refers to the chest-length undershirt.
